Hope Shifting

Finding our Acceptance, Security, Purpose, Value and Significance

This book is an attempt to help people see the difference between world, religion, and the gospel.  So often when we do the work of evangelism people hear “you are calling me to religious behavior”.  Others, who have grown up in the church, who want to escape religious behavior think their only option is “worldliness”.  Hope-shifting provides the third option:  the gospel.  Hope-shifting attempts to call us out of putting our hope in worldly things and religious behavior by calling us to believe in the work that Jesus has already done for us.  Hope-shifting is a book that helps people evangelize in particularly religious cultures by articulating the message of Jesus differently.

Engage the Church

This book is an attempt to help pastors and churches that preach the gospel and love people well but struggle with building leadership and structure. Engage the Church enables leadership teams to think about building structure for the new or existing church, and raise up teams to plant other churches. Engage the church follows a simple methodology that any team can read and work on together.
